As the members have been asking for long DFI lighter version for uses on slow connections and mobile phones is here available.

Please make sure you read this post on how to use it :-




1. from the dfi default page go to STYLE CHOOSER located at the bottom left
2. open the tab(drop down menu) - choose DFI Mobile

please see the mobile style has very less features supported , no blog , gallery , chatbox , homepage and many pther cosmetic features that are present on the DEFAULT SKIN . there should be no problem sin reading and posting on the threads at anytime though


3. IF from the mobile skin you want to shift back to dfi default skin with all the features then please click on the tab at the top right title DFI DEFAULT SKIN.





The mobile skin is fast and easy to use on any mobile handset not only smart phones or high end sets so now enjoy dfi on the go better ,itconsumes very little resources and loads very fast and simple <just what you need to see while on the go >










Some features and look of the skin is given below have a look any problems just contact dfi staff they will help you out , <update to the mobile skin - it will recognize any mobile device and load the mobile skin as default while any computer the default is the pc skin>




It has VERY low bandwidth requirements - 15 times less on my site - 20K as opposed to 300K for forumhome.
